toothpaste just "scratches" down the area around the scratch. It makes it so that you might be able to get one more read out of it so you can copy it. Not a solution imo.

Go to the auto parts store and get some clear instrument panel polish. It's made for plastic panels. I've used it with great results. Be sure you make all your polishing strokes from inside to outside directly or vice versa, no swirling motions. Use a soft cloth.
